Microsoft Releases New Windows 11 Insider Preview Build to Dev Channel

Microsoft announced the release of Windows 11 Insider Preview Build 26200.5581 (KB5055651) to the Dev Channel. This update is part of the company’s ongoing effort to test and refine new features and improvements for the upcoming Windows 11 version 24H2. The release includes energy saver integration with Microsoft Intune, a significant addition for IT administrators managing Windows 11 devices.

Energy Saver Comes to Microsoft Intune

A key feature in this build is the ability to manage energy saver settings in Windows 11 through Microsoft Intune. This integration enables IT administrators to control power management policies on Windows 11 PCs via group policies or Mobile Device Management (MDM) configurations. The energy saver feature intelligently optimizes battery life by limiting background activity and reducing screen brightness, thereby lowering power consumption and supporting environmental sustainability. Administrators can activate this policy using the Local Group Policy Editor or the Microsoft Intune Admin Center.

Taskbar and System Tray Enhancements

The update introduces visual adjustments to the taskbar, making the "needy state pill" (indicating apps requiring attention) wider and more noticeable. For example, Microsoft Teams notifications on the taskbar will now be more visible. Additionally, administrators can now allow users to unpin specific apps from the taskbar, preventing them from being repinned during policy refresh cycles. This feature is configurable using the new PinGeneration option.

HDR and Graphics Improvements

Users will find enhanced HDR management settings under Settings > System > Display > HDR. The update clarifies the wording for "Use HDR" to better indicate supported media types. For PCs with HDR displays, users can now stream HDR video even when HDR is disabled in settings. Those with Dolby Vision displays can also toggle Dolby Vision mode independently of HDR, offering more flexibility in display preferences.

Reminders for Windows Insiders

Microsoft reminded Dev Channel participants that updates are based on Windows 11, version 24H2, delivered through an enablement package. The company uses Control Feature Rollout technology to gradually introduce features to Insiders, with the option to toggle on early access to the latest updates via Settings > Windows Update. As always, feedback is crucial, and users are encouraged to report issues through the Feedback Hub.
